#15 Make sure average line is on top of others

Aaron noted that the average line should be drawn "on top of" all the other (data) series to make it easier to see.


    David Benn - 2009-09-11
    David Benn - 2009-09-12
    David Benn - 2010-01-16

    Modified observation plot pane code to specify a different rendering order so that means plot appears on top via the XYPlot.setSeriesRenderingOrder() method (see line 150 in AbstractObservationPlotPane). This works but only means datapoints not join lines and error bars appear to render last. Still looking for a way to bring these lines "to the front".

    This raises another question for me. Given that a means series is derived from just a single band, why don't we only show the means series and the series from which it was derived. Or even just the means series. This would be by default of course. The user could make other bands visible via the usual series visibility dialog.

    David Benn - 2010-03-06

    Reading the JFreeChart manual I recently purchased has not shed any new light on this problem. It may be a bug in JFreeChart.

    The main thing is for the mean datapoints to be easily visible. This has been achieved (see last comment).

    Reducing the priority of this problem. It still should be addressed, but probably not until after phase 1 now.

    David Benn - 2010-03-06
    David Benn - 2010-04-26
    Sara Beck - 2011-01-06
    Sara Beck - 2011-01-06

    Nice but not essential at all.


